An address in Arlington will not tell you what is buried under it. Two houses four miles apart in this Texas city can sit over pipe laid two generations apart, in two different materials, failing for two unrelated reasons. That is the first thing worth understanding before anybody talks about a dig.
Arlington did not grow in a single push the way the newer suburbs around it did. There is an older residential grid near the original core and around the university campus, a very large mid-century expansion that came with manufacturing and with the entertainment and stadium district, later subdivisions filling the gaps, and new construction still going in on the southern and western edges. Each of those waves was piped with whatever was standard at the time, and all of it is still in the ground.
So the camera in Arlington has two jobs, and identification is the first of them. A camera inspection run from the cleanout tells the crew what the pipe is made of, how long the individual lengths are, where the joints fall and how the material is behaving, and only then what has gone wrong. Everything downstream of that, whether a liner is possible, whether a bursting head will pull cleanly, how wide the trench has to be, follows from the answer.
What the Material Tells You
- Vitrified clay: short lengths and a great many joints, and roots find those joints. Root intrusion at a cracked hub is the classic failure and it comes back after cutting unless the joint is dealt with.
- Cast iron: corrodes from the inside, scales, and channels along the invert until the bottom of the pipe thins and gives way. A cable passes and the flow still slows, because the bore has closed in. It is a common finding under the mid-century streets in Arlington.
- Early thin-wall plastic: strong enough when it went in, and prone to deflection and to settling into a bellied line where the bedding was thin.
- Bituminous fiber conduit: occasionally the camera finds it in a postwar run. It softens and deforms into an oval, and nothing goes inside it that will hold its shape.
- Modern PVC pipe: usually sound, with any trouble at a gasketed joint or at a transition to older pipe near the connection.
A sound pipe that is simply fouled has a cheaper answer than a machine in the yard. Grease, scale and soft buildup in a structurally intact line respond to hydro jetting in Arlington, and routine blockages are handled by drain cleaning in Arlington. Excavation belongs to the cases where the pipe itself has stopped being a pipe.

Can the driveway or sidewalk be put back after the dig?
The trench is backfilled and compacted in lifts, which is what keeps the surface from settling later. Restoration beyond that is scoped and agreed on site before anything is opened, so you know in advance what is included for sod, walk or drive. Where an access-pit method can avoid a hard surface altogether, the crew will say so during the estimate.
Why does my sewer line block again a few months after it is cleared?
Because cleaning removes what is in the pipe and cannot change the shape of the pipe. Roots that entered through a cracked joint grow back through the same opening. A section that has settled will keep holding water at rest and will keep catching solids. If the same short stretch keeps failing, the camera will show the reason, and that finding is what an excavation plan is built on.
Am I responsible for the sewer line all the way to the street?
Usually the buried lateral serving your building is yours and the main in the street belongs to the municipality. Where the line between the two falls, at the property line, at the curb or at the main itself, is set by your jurisdiction and is worth confirming with them. The soil on my side of Arlington is sandy. Does that change how the trench is dug?
It changes the hole more than it changes the pipe. The loose post oak sand on the western side of the city has very little cohesion, so a vertical face will not stand on its own. The excavation is benched or shored and kept wider at the top, and that width is what decides how much surface gets disturbed. It matters again on the way back in, because sand returned without compaction migrates and leaves the new run unsupported. On the heavier clay to the east the same depth of trench behaves differently, which is one reason a neighbor's job is a poor guide to yours.
A house on the next street had a liner put in. Why might that not work on my line?
Because Arlington is not one housing stock, it is four laid over each other, and the pipe under one street is often nothing like the pipe two miles away. Vitrified clay, cast iron, bituminous fiber conduit and early plastic each fail in their own way, and lining and pipe bursting are only available where the host pipe, the depth, the condition on the footage and working access at both ends all allow it. Naming the material is the camera's first job here for that reason: it decides what has failed and which methods are genuinely on the table. How do I find out what my sewer pipe is made of?
A camera inspection from the cleanout shows it directly. The crew can see the length of the individual pieces, the shape of the joints, the surface texture inside the pipe and how the material is wearing. That identification decides whether lining is possible, whether a bursting head will pull cleanly and how the trench has to be built if an open cut is the answer.

What Makes Sewer Line Replacement the Better Option Here?
The threshold is structural. A pipe that has kept its shape and its fall can be cleaned and put back into service, and that remains the cheaper and less disruptive path for as long as it holds. Once the wall is gone, once the joints are open to soil, or once the run has settled out of grade, cleaning buys time and nothing more.
In an older Arlington neighborhood the trigger is usually cumulative: a clay line with roots at several joints, cleared repeatedly, where the camera now shows displaced hubs and soil washing in. In mid-century stock it is usually corrosion, with the invert thinned out and the bore closing. In the newer parts of the city it is far more likely to be a single defect worth a spot repair. Same service, three different jobs.
